Title :
Interferometric detection of small frequency differences

Abstract :
A method of use of certain scanning interferometers is described by which frequency differences of the order of one percent of the usual resolving width can be detected and measured. When so used, one relatively simple instrument is capable of displaying frequency differences in the 10-kHz to 1-GHz range in input signals at optical frequencies.
